MRP 137: Seismic Exploration Agreements 21.01.2022 30:15
Seismic exploration is the process of using seismic energy to probe below the surface of the earth to search for oil and gas. The agreements that grant a company access to land in order to shoot seismic is called a seismic survey agreement.
